I would go as far as to say that this thread is now outdated. I figure dark tunes were 2008, and from 2009-10 have all but died out. Sure, there's still 16Bit and Boregore, etc.. but how many of you actually play that stuff?
A minority. I'd say that EVERY mixtape and set I've been playing in the last six months has been positive. At the very least, there's a lot more 2 Step now, a lot more soulful tunes.. and a hell of a lot more with lyrics, blue note jazz, etc. etc. etc.
So.. this thread just isn't even relevant anymore. I'd say that I haven't really heard anything dark being played out for a seriously long time. That's the product of a bygone age.. and as we near spring the summer vibes are already happening.

Where i live it isn't (Florida), because every club or beach party i hear the apocolyptic sound still. thanks for all the submissions, ive got some catching up to do. although, i must admit, lately ive been entrenched in future garage, funky (the deeper techy side of it, not "snare house" or "marching band music" as i call it), and juke.
i have to say though, 2 years ago, i got sick of dubstep after only a few months of playing it out (but continued to play it anyway). immediately i noticed how narrow spectrum the music palette is (or was?). got tired of the snare always on the 3, gibberish black ragga style vocals no one knows what the f they're saying, etc.
